Kinds of Welder’s Certificates

Although the AWS’ standard CW credential opens the door for most job opportunities, a number of fields will require a specific certificate. Several of the most-well-known of these appear below.

  • ASME Certification for welders that handle boiler and pressure vessels
  •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der
  • API Certification for welders who work with pipelines in the oil and gas industry
  • CWI and SCWI Certificates for inspectors and senior inspectors

The following graphic displays wages and labor forecasts for welders in Ohio through 2022.

Ohio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 13,760 14,370 4% 400
Ohio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$24,800 $35,300 $50,800

Source: O*Net Online

Overview of Welding Specialist Classes

You have decided that you want to become a welding specialist, and right now you have got to decide which of the welding schools is the ideal one. The first step in getting started in a position as a welding specialist is to pick which of the top welding courses will be right for you. To start with, determine if the program has been endorsed or accredited by the AWS. Right after checking the accreditation situation, you need to definitely investigate a little bit deeper to make certain that the program you want can supply you with the correct training.

  • Make certain the college’s program features classes in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
  • Look for programs that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
  • Determine if the college provides financial support
  • Make certain the college teaches with tools that satisfies the latest trade standards
